log in
Trump supporters on Capitol Hill, Jan 6th. Photo: Blink O'fanaye / Flickr / cropped from original / CC BY-NC 2.0, license linked at bottom of article

Impeachment will not defeat Trumpism

The US left must constitute itself as an independent pole, and not fall in behind attempts to rehabilitate business as usual, argues Kevin Ovenden

  • Written by Kevin Ovenden
  • Category: Analysis
Delta delivers Covid-19 vaccine to France. Photo: Delta News Hub/cropped from original/licensed under CC2.0, linked at bottom of article

Emmanuel Macron’s Covid vaccine blues

France’s beleaguered regime is undergoing a fresh battering, this time for the snail-paced roll-out of its Covid vaccination programme, writes Susan Ram

  • Written by Susan Ram
  • Category: Analysis

Help boost radical media and socialist organisation

Join Counterfire today

Join Now